Abstract
The National Institute of Standards and Technology performs research that when applied can reduce the fire losses in the U.S. A focus of the research is on advanced technology for the first responder. Currently means are being explored to enhance the information available to first responders, by creating standards for transmission, display and use of information from building emergency systems that are compatible with GIS databases. Research is being conducted on new sensors and signal analysis that can detect impending collapse of buildings. New technology for reliable voice and data communications are being evaluated.
